在AI语音开放平台上开发语音翻译工具的教程
在当今这个信息爆炸的时代,人工智能技术正在以前所未有的速度发展。语音识别和语音翻译作为AI技术的代表,已经广泛应用于各个领域。随着AI语音开放平台的不断涌现,开发语音翻译工具变得前所未有的简单。本文将为您详细讲解如何在AI语音开放平台上开发语音翻译工具,并分享一个开发者的真实故事。
一、AI语音开放平台简介
AI语音开放平台是指由一些大型科技公司提供的,可以供开发者免费或付费使用的语音识别、语音合成、语音翻译等语音技术接口。目前,国内外知名的AI语音开放平台有百度AI开放平台、科大讯飞开放平台、腾讯云AI开放平台等。
二、开发语音翻译工具的步骤
- 注册并登录AI语音开放平台
首先,您需要在选择的AI语音开放平台上注册账号并登录。注册过程中,请确保填写真实有效的信息,以便后续获取技术支持和资源。
- 申请语音翻译API
登录平台后,您需要申请语音翻译API。不同平台的申请流程略有差异,但一般包括以下步骤:
(1)进入语音翻译API申请页面;
(2)填写相关信息,如应用名称、应用描述、开发者姓名等;
(3)提交申请,等待审核。
- 获取API密钥
申请成功后,平台会向您发送一封邮件,其中包含API密钥。请妥善保管该密钥,因为它是您调用语音翻译API的唯一凭证。
- 集成语音翻译API
在您的项目中集成语音翻译API,具体步骤如下:
(1)引入相关库:根据您所使用的编程语言,引入对应的API库;
(2)初始化:根据API文档,初始化语音翻译API实例;
(3)配置API密钥:将获取的API密钥配置到API实例中;
(4)调用翻译接口:根据API文档,调用翻译接口,实现语音翻译功能。
- 测试与优化
在完成集成后,对语音翻译工具进行测试,确保其正常运行。如有问题,根据API文档进行优化,直至满足需求。
三、开发者真实故事
小张是一名软件开发爱好者,擅长使用Python编程。在一次偶然的机会,他了解到AI语音开放平台,并决定尝试开发一款语音翻译工具。以下是他的开发经历:
- 学习AI语音开放平台
小张首先在网络上查找了相关资料,了解了各大AI语音开放平台的特点和优势。经过比较,他选择了百度AI开放平台。
- 注册并申请API
按照平台的申请流程,小张成功注册了账号并申请了语音翻译API。
- 集成API
小张利用Python编程语言,将百度AI语音翻译API集成到自己的项目中。在集成过程中,他遇到了不少难题,但通过查阅文档、请教社区和请教朋友,最终成功解决了问题。
- 测试与优化
小张在本地测试了语音翻译工具,发现其性能良好。随后,他开始优化代码,提高翻译准确度和速度。
- 发布与推广
在完成开发后,小张将语音翻译工具发布到GitHub,并分享到技术社区。不久,他的工具受到了广泛关注,吸引了众多用户。
总结
通过本文的讲解,相信您已经掌握了在AI语音开放平台上开发语音翻译工具的方法。在开发过程中,遇到问题是难免的,但只要坚持不懈,勇于探索,相信您也能成为一名优秀的开发者。
猜你喜欢:AI语音聊天